Skip to content

Commit 584512a

Browse files
committed
[llvm][blake3] Prefix blake3_hash4_neon
In #147948 blake3_hash4_neon became a public symbol (no longer static). Like other APIs introduced, it was not prefixed, resulting in conflicts if libblake3 and LLVM are both linked statically into the same binary.
1 parent 9f20397 commit 584512a

File tree

1 file changed

+1
-0
lines changed

1 file changed

+1
-0
lines changed

llvm/lib/Support/BLAKE3/llvm_blake3_prefix.h

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-41,5 +41,6 @@
4141
#define blake3_hash_many_avx512 llvm_blake3_hash_many_avx512
4242
#define _blake3_hash_many_avx512 _llvm_blake3_hash_many_avx512
4343
#define blake3_hash_many_neon llvm_blake3_hash_many_neon
44+
#define blake3_hash4_neon llvm_blake3_hash4_neon
4445

4546
#endif /* LLVM_BLAKE3_PREFIX_H */

0 commit comments

Comments
 (0)